Jurgen Klopp laughed at suggestions that Barcelona had been quoted a price to buy Philippe Coutinho in the January transfer window.
An amused Klopp said to papers in the UK: “Named a price? Interesting.
“There is absolutely nothing to say about this. Of course Phil is still essential for us.
“Should we stop thinking about him in the moment just because there are more stories about him in the newspapers in Spain?”
